If you're poorly prepared, airports and flying can be tough. But there's no need to panic. Follow these tips and tricks and enjoy a hassle-free start to your time in Lechlade. What to pack in your hand luggage:
- The secret to having a worry-free travel experience is to be prepared. Start with the essentials: passport, official ID, credit cards and vital medications. Next, bring items that'll help keep you entertained, like some electronic gadgets or a good read. It's also a wise idea to pack your chargers, a neck pillow and a pair of headphones. Last but not least, be sure to toss in toiletry items like a toothbrush, cleansing wipes and a clean set of clothes.
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:
- Leave all your full-sized bottles of shampoo and conditioner in your checked baggage. Any gels or liquids in your carry-on suitcase lar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) will be confiscated by security. Sharp objects, like your precious Swiss Army knife, and dangerous products which are flammable or explosive, such as aerosol cans, spray paint and gasoline, are also banned.
What to wear on a flight:
- Comfort should be your priority when deciding what to wear on board. Loose, breathable clothing is a wise option, as are roomy, closed-toe shoes.
- De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clot condition caused by prolonged periods of inactivity, can be a risk on long-haul flights. Make a point of walking around the cabin or do some gentle exercises in your seat to improve your circulation.
